CROUS de Ziguinchor : les délégués dénoncent la gestion du Dr Salif Baldé
Tensions have risen at the Ziguinchor Regional Center for University Social Services (CROUS/Z). Meeting in general assembly, the members of the student council denounced the opaque management practices of the director, Dr. Salif Baldé.
According to their coordinator, Landing Goudiaby, the new management cites budgetary difficulties to justify the non-regularization of agents on fixed-term contracts, the reduction of temporary staff and the precariousness of certain functions.
“We believed in this speech and supported the request for a budget increase. But today, we see that new recruitments are being carried out at the expense of workers awaiting regularization,” he laments.
The delegates also denounce transfers deemed arbitrary, the sidelining of agents assigned without specific tasks and the loss of their benefits, plunging several employees into financial difficulties.
Another cause for outrage: the non-payment of contributions to IPRES and the Social Security Fund, despite deductions at source. "For six months, employees have received nothing. It's unacceptable," Mr. Goudiaby protested.
The college claims to have exhausted all avenues of mediation, including with the labor inspectorate, and is now leaving the matter to the unions, who could consider a strike.
When contacted, the director of CROUS/Z, Dr. Salif Baldé, indicated he was traveling and referred inquiries to his communications department. According to internal sources, he is expected to respond upon his return.
